Transaction 50fefcfb41b33b18385ebaa921a18fb160f29680aa6e7276f786ebb76a0dc1fe
1 Input
2 Outputs
- 50fefcfb41b33b18385ebaa921a18fb160f29680aa6e7276f786ebb76a0dc1fe:0
- 50fefcfb41b33b18385ebaa921a18fb160f29680aa6e7276f786ebb76a0dc1fe:1
value 2682000
address 3MuCCQAWYwmhh36k2R5SMxLZcstCJwems7
value 85315518
address 12wKNM8Urd2KT7txuhoMTuGp5W4qk4Et4a